Output 66c75181e89a461a555dff0c1305329abda14b409ced8b1935554c9d029686b0:0

value
49806456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e60b682cca3384e22fc8063da2534b8a244571f0 OP_EQUALVERIFY OP_CHECKSIG
address
1MyN5gwYHwNXKXT9GNsptiYFqbXE43f1tC
transaction
66c75181e89a461a555dff0c1305329abda14b409ced8b1935554c9d029686b0
spent
true